Anson or Hanson is a relatively unusual name probably originating in Yorkshire and spreading
to Cumberland, Westmorland and Northumberland.

The History, Gazetteer & Directory of Cumberland, 1847 (available on the internet) gives information about the
Wetheral Parish, Township, Priory, Church, adjoining areas, and the names of some residents.
